Welcome to the Partner Technical Specialist - Storage Brand role! As a Partner Technical Specialist, you will be a crucial part of our sales team, responsible for understanding and promoting IBM's storage solutions within the IBM Ecosystem. You will be joining a highly successful team, comprising talented individuals from all over Australia and New Zealand. Your role and responsibilities As a Partner Technical Specialist in the Storage Brand, your key responsibilities include: Influencing Partner Technical Strategy: Incorporate and embed IBM's storage technology portfolio into Partner's reference architectures, practices, and solutions. Work to position IBM's technology against competitors. Enabling Sales and Technical Sellers: Increase Partner technical capabilities by enabling their sales and technical sellers to demonstrate and conduct Proof of Concept (PoC) of IBM storage technology at scale with clients. Leverage technical insights to work alongside Ecosystem Partners to remove technical inhibitors and co-deliver demos with Partners, support partner PoC, advise partners on Solution Assurance, and progress opportunities to closure. Cover various Ecosystem Motions (Sell, Build, and Service) as dictated by market opportunity and Partner growth opportunity. Storage Integration and Hybrid Cloud: Integrate cross-vendor storage systems and understand how your client's solution interacts with other vendor solutions and their data centres and hybrid cloud solutions. Present and demonstrate the capability of the IBM Storage portfolio in a range of environments from purpose-built application platforms, on-premises deployments or multi/hybrid cloud solutions. Education and Training: Education and training go hand in hand with your journey at IBM. You will be expected to complete product-specific training, including stand and deliver presentations to demonstrate competency. As this will be a technical sales role, you will begin your learning at IBM by being enrolled in the Global Sales School. Global Sales School aims to prepare sales professionals for their roles within the IBM Ecosystem, enabling them to effectively engage with partners and clients, understand and demonstrate IBM's technology solutions, and contribute to the growth of the overall Ecosystem. Client Success and Business Growth: Work with Ecosystem Partners to identify opportunities and progress technical sales, resulting in client success and IBM Technology business growth in your territory. Identify opportunities to expand Ecosystem partner skills coverage for your specialty in order to scale success in your territory. Required Education None Preferred Education Technical Diploma Required Technical and Professional Expertise A background in technical sales roles such as Solution Architecture with a focus on infrastructure and cloud will enhance your success in this role. Previous vendor experience could be useful but is not necessary. Preferred Technical and Professional Experience Virtual infrastructure skills such as vSphere, HyperV, and KVM. Network and Storage Fabric experience. OpenShift experience and familiarization with containerized workloads. Cyber Resiliency experience with storage brands. A cyber security background would be useful.
